Superb glazed stoneware lamp created by Joël Courjault for Keraluc in Quimper in the 1970s. A graduate of the Fine Arts School of Rennes, Joël Courjault is renowned for his delicate work with the material and his subtly nuanced glazes, combining raised textures and nature-inspired patterns. This lamp features a richly worked floral and geometric design in earth tones, beige, brown, and blue, typical of Keraluc's artisanal production. The base is engraved with the artist's signature along with the words "Diplômé des Beaux-Arts – Keraluc – Quimper."
